What happens when fashion, performance, and pure adrenaline meet after dark in one of Dubai’s most iconic shopping spots? Enter the Mostro.
From now until June 26, PUMA is taking over Mall of the Emirates with Free The Mostros, a first-of-its-kind activation that transforms the sneaker drop into something much bolder: an immersive, all-day (but especially all-night) challenge where the brave walk away with more than just bragging rights.

At the center of it all: The Mostro Pod. Step inside, and the rules are simple — but the pressure? Not so much. A glowing message appears: “You have 10 seconds.” A hidden compartment reveals itself. Lights flicker. Sounds distract. You’ll need pure instinct, quick hands, and nerves of steel to grab the prize. If you win, you walk out with a pair of PUMA Mostros or exclusive gear. If not? You just became part of the spectacle; because yes, the entire thing plays out in real time, with bystanders watching your every move through external projections.
"This isn’t just a sneaker launch — it’s a call to those who dare to be different," says Jonathan Bannister, Head of Marketing at PUMA. “The Mostro is a statement of individuality, and Free The Mostros brings that energy to life.”
The PUMA Mostro, named after the Italian word for “monster”, is unapologetic by design. A revival of early-2000s futurism, the silhouette is low, sleek, and just the right amount of spiky. Now reimagined in a high-voltage yellow and black, the Mostro makes its entrance in three editions: Prime, Ecstasy, and OG, each crafted to stand out, disrupt, and redefine sneaker culture.
